What is a farmer's assistant called?

A farmer's assistant is often referred to as a farmhand, farm worker, or agricultural laborer. These roles typically involve tasks such as planting, harvesting, and maintaining crops or livestock, often requiring physical stamina and knowledge of farming practices.

What does a farm assistant do?

A farm assistant supports agricultural operations by performing tasks such as planting, harvesting, feeding livestock, operating machinery, and maintaining farm equipment. They often work outdoors in various weather conditions and may need physical stamina and basic knowledge of farming practices. The role may also involve following safety protocols and using tools like tractors and hand tools.

What farm job pays the most?

Farm managers and specialized roles such as agricultural engineers or crop consultants tend to have the highest salaries among farm jobs, often earning over $70,000 annually. These positions typically require experience, advanced skills, and sometimes certifications, and they involve overseeing farm operations, implementing technology, or managing large-scale agricultural projects.

How much do farmers assistants make?

Farmers assistants typically earn between $12 and $20 per hour, depending on experience, location, and the specific farm. Entry-level positions may pay closer to minimum wage, while experienced workers or those with specialized skills can earn higher wages. Salaries can also vary based on seasonal work and additional responsibilities.

Farm Assistant

Hartville, OH

Pegasus Farm is currently searching for a full-time Farm Assistant to assist the Farm Manager in performance of all aspects of maintenance of Pegasus Farm’s stables, grounds, buildings, vehicles and equipment.

Pegasus Farm is a local nonprofit organization who supports and empowers individuals with diverse needs through our therapeutic equestrian programs and adult day services.  

What can we offer YOU?

  • Paid Time Off
  • Possible health insurance

Qualifications:

  • Experience in property, building and grounds equipment maintenance, as well as vehicle maintenance
  • General knowledge of electrical, plumbing and mechanical systems
  • Ability to effectively operate farm and grounds equipment safely and independently
  • Proof of driver’s license and insurance
  • Ability to pass a background check

Responsibilities:

  • Conditioning, grading, and watering of the equine riding arenas
  • Maintenance of farm equipment and vehicles, including preventive maintenance and documentation
  • Assist with maintaining buildings, building equipment and grounds equipment
  • Assist with construction projects
  • Seasonal tasks including but not limited to; mowing, trimming, landscaping tree trimming and removal, snow removal, safety salt dispersal
  • Maintenance of pastures including routine mowing, trimming and spraying and maintaining the shelters
  • Assist with other routine tasks such as manure management and removal and rubbish removal, etc.
  • Assist in supporting volunteers assigned to property, buildings and equipment improvements
  • Adhere to all Pegasus Farm policy and procedures as set forth in the Pegasus Farm Employee Handbook
